Hello from sunny Tampa Florida. After much testing, it looks like I need to replace the alternator in my 78 FJ40. I called Toyota and it seems like I the part has been discontinued. Can anyone here give me some insight as far as which aftermarkets / parts store / internet alternators they have had good or bad luck with? I want to do this once and make sure its right.

Thanks
 
I would look for a good auto-electric shop and have them test it. Sometimes the problem is not where you think and even if it is the alternator, it could be as simple as a bad diode. Ask two or three shops who they farm out their electrical stuff to. I have "tested" two alternators at chain autoparts stores and was told they were baaad, only to take them to a shop and find they were OK.
Many of the countermonkeys do not know how to use the test equipment.
